I have never seen such incredible bartenders. This isn't like the Vegas flashy flair type, it's like freestyle flavor profile custom cocktail creation. I asked for a recommendation of something herbal/botanical light but spicy, like peppery. And her brow furrowed for a lil bit while she put it together, then she went and made it with a bunch of ingredients i never heard of, was exactly the kinda drink I was hoping for, and the price was way lower than I expected for that quality of service and drink. I'm definitely going back again before I end my vacation.

If you’re in the service industry, especially a bartender, the teardrop lounge is a great place for an early evening drink. From the clear and distinct categories to the cocktail map, they’ll make sure you love what you got and why. I had a Hotel Nacional because I felt like a summery refreshing daiquiri and tried the Love in the Afternoon (pluots + basil is a divine combo) and if I had more time and stamina, I would have tried another. Likely to stop back in with my partner when we’re traveling together. A Pearl District favorite.
